5 Reasons You Might Carry Out A Free Government Records Search

A free government records search is a great way to help you discover public information about somebody. You can find marriage records, information about parking tickets, criminal activity plus a whole lot more if you have access to public records.

Government public records are records which are open to the public. When most people hear this, they think that the information should be completely free. While ideally that is true, the reality is that free information is scattered all over the internet. To have access to a high quality database, you normally have to pay a modest membership fee.

What kind of information can you gain access to by doing a government records search?

1. In case you wanted to find out if a person has a criminal history, this is an excellent way to do it. By performing a lookup, you'll not only discover their criminal record, but also their court records, so you understand what happened. If they were sentenced to jail, it is also possible to locate their inmate records.

2. Finding out about someone's marriage record may be crucial if you're thinking of getting married. A lot of people want to carry out a background check, just in case. It can also be important if you want to find out if you're still legally married, in case you didn't follow the correct procedures when you got a divorce.

3. Another typical use of government public records is discovering exactly where someone's buried. Not long ago, you'd have to phone the county offices of lots of counties before you'd discover information about exactly where someone was buried. By using government records, you'll also discover how they died, when they died and when they were buried.
